To improve well-being, it’s important to reserve judgement [1]. This means waiting before forming opinions about others. By doing so, you reduce stress and avoid misunderstandings. This practice leads to healthier relationships and a more positive outlook. Overall, learning to reserve judgement can lead to a happier and more peaceful life.
